Mass transfer of gas customers accelerating: 200,000 households switch to subsidized rate in one month

Major energy companies continue to register large volumes of customer transfers to regulated natural gas rates, due to Government-enabled help to lower the bill amid the energy crisis. After the first avalanche in recent months, contract transfers have not stopped, in fact, they have intensified so far this year.

Main gas companies obliged to submit different offers regulated fares (tariffs of last resort, called TUR)), they are dealing with a real avalanche of demand to jump into regulated business. A complete trade reversal compared to the trend in recent years, when the customer base of regulated tariffs has shrunk and free market tariffs have grown.

In the heat of state aid, major energy groups added nearly 200,000 new customers to regulated gas tariff marketers in January alone., according to internal data of companies accessed by EL PERIÓDICO DE ESPAÑA from the Prensa Ibérica group. A new large customer transfer in addition to the nearly 550,000 registrations in regulated tariffs recorded in the last months of last year – price set by the Government and currently applying big discounts.

Naturgy, the main operator of the Spanish gas market, added 83,000 customers to its last resource supplier portfolio during January. The company, led by Francisco Reynés, confirmed that it had included 230,000 customers in its regulated gas tariff in 2022, of which 190,000 were concentrated in the last part of the year.

Iberdrola increased its regulated rate client portfolio with 70,000 new contracts in January. As confirmed by the company, the group has more than tripled the volume of TUR contracts in a four-month period, from 111,000 customers at the end of September to a total of 370,000 users at the end of last month.

Endesa, which currently does not detail the increase in its customers with regulated gas rates, expects to announce its financial results at the end of the month. The Enel subsidiary points out that its customer addition rate is slightly lower than it recorded in October and November, when, as a last resort, it added more than 30,000 new users to its retailer.

total energies confirms that the number of customers of the regulated rate marketer is growing rapidly. It tripled its contract portfolio in 2022, from 60,000 to a total of 182,000 at the end of December. And in January, the company added another 33,000 new customer records, totaling 215,000 contracts.

subsidized rates

Right now, About 2.2 million homes have regulated gas rates of more than 33%. It’s above the volume when the executive activated its last aid plan last October. However, the number of customers covered by the free gas market rates, whose prices are freely determined by the companies, is much larger than the number of customers of the regulated business whose prices are determined quarterly by the Government based on the evolution of international prices. hydrocarbons, but their increase has the maximum limit since last year. rates Mercado Libre is still the majority option and around 6 million customers they still hold on to them.

The government activated a million-dollar package of measures last October to lower the price of regulated gas tariffs. In practice, this means direct subsidies to the bills of those customers who charge from the big energy companies.

A Anti-crisis shield with 3,000 million euros in aid It plans to continue to limit by law the increases applicable to already over 2 million regulated gas tariff customers through 2023, and also to create a new type of discounted rate for homes with central heating in the neighborhood community (about 2,000 neighboring communities would now have joined).

CNMC investigation

The National Markets and Competition Commission (CNMC) has launched an investigation into major gas companies to analyze whether they deliberately hindered large-scale transfers of customers to regulated gas rates when demand avalanches began.

The agency has activated an information file and requests periodic and permanent information from the client. Naturgy, Endesa, Iberdrola and Totalenergies About the technical and personnel resources used to deal with rate change requests, following many consumers’ complaints about waiting times, lack of information and difficulties in completing the contract.

Amid the avalanche of requests to change the rate, Competition decided to expand the investigation to watch for other possible fraudulent behavior linked to this customer transfer. As part of the same dossier, the CNMC included a specific oversight of whether energy companies violated new regulations mandating them to stop asking their customers for additional services (maintenance, emergencies, equipment overhaul…) when they change their services. company.

It is emphasized that customer service channels have been strengthened in recent months to meet the increase in demands from large energy companies and customers who want to move from the free market to the regulated market. registered in recent months. An improvement in procedures that are also clearly recognized by the Ministry of Ecological Transition.

The industry wants reform

Companies in the gas sector are only warning of the consequences of measures taken to reduce one type of tariff. Gas companies are warned that the Ministry’s Ecological Transition assistance plan, which is for regulated rates only, could distort the market and threaten the stability of companies offering rates in the free market, and therefore pressure the Government to put pressure on it. Take measures to reduce the invoice for all customers, not just a part.

Employer sedigas Bringing together marketers, transport and distribution network companies, and suppliers in the industry – asked the Government to: allows any marketer to offer regulated gas rates or apply similar subsidies to free market rates. The government predicted that different alternatives are being explored to speed up client switching, but has not taken any action for the time being and the industry has denied that any reform will be approved in this regard.
